ios開發(fā)循環(huán)引用舉例 ios循環(huán)引用原理

【OC梳理】循環(huán)引用及解決

1、所以只要在block使用完時把 person 指針置為nil就可以解決這個循環(huán)引用。

十多年的江都網(wǎng)站建設(shè)經(jīng)驗,針對設(shè)計、前端、開發(fā)、售后、文案、推廣等六對一服務(wù),響應(yīng)快,48小時及時工作處理。成都全網(wǎng)營銷推廣的優(yōu)勢是能夠根據(jù)用戶設(shè)備顯示端的尺寸不同,自動調(diào)整江都建站的顯示方式,使網(wǎng)站能夠適用不同顯示終端,在瀏覽器中調(diào)整網(wǎng)站的寬度,無論在任何一種瀏覽器上瀏覽網(wǎng)站,都能展現(xiàn)優(yōu)雅布局與設(shè)計,從而大程度地提升瀏覽體驗。創(chuàng)新互聯(lián)公司從事“江都網(wǎng)站設(shè)計”,“江都網(wǎng)站推廣”以來,每個客戶項目都認真落實執(zhí)行。

2、首先打開一個excel表格,可以看到彈出了一個對話框提醒循環(huán)引用警告。然后點擊上方工具欄中的文件。再點擊文件選項卡下的選項。在彈出的對話框中點擊公式,在右側(cè)勾選啟用迭代計算。

3、打開Excel如果提示循環(huán)引用;點擊“公式”中的“錯誤檢查”;在列表中選擇“循環(huán)引用”,查看循環(huán)引用單元格;找到單元格并修改公式;就不會提升循環(huán)引用了。

4、,首先,打開excel之后,點擊窗口上方選項卡菜單中的“公式”選項卡。2,在公式選項卡中,點擊“檢查錯誤”按鈕,在彈出的菜單中選擇“循環(huán)引用”,并點擊后面的問題單元格。

5、strong和weak,相當于非ARC環(huán)境里的retain和assign。只要存在一個強引用,對象就會一直存在,不會被銷毀。

6、首先打開【excel文檔】,會彈出【公式引用】對話框。雙擊對話框里面的【單元格】,查看編輯框顯示的公式。然后點擊單元格,直接輸入對應(yīng)的數(shù)據(jù),選擇【保存】,如下圖所示。

你真的了解循環(huán)引用嗎?

1、當一個單元格內(nèi)的公式直接或間接地應(yīng)用了這個公式本身所在的單元格時,就稱為循環(huán)引用。只要打開的工作簿中有一個包含循環(huán)引用,Microsoft Excel 都將無法自動計算所有打開的工作簿。

2、在工具欄點擊”公式“選項卡,點擊右側(cè)的”錯誤檢查“下拉框的“循環(huán)引用”,修改循環(huán)錯誤即可。 循環(huán)引用的兩個單元格出現(xiàn)如下藍色箭頭符號。找到藍色箭頭符號,取消循環(huán)公式即可。

3、再打開Excel就不會提升循環(huán)引用了??偨Y(jié):打開Excel如果提示循環(huán)引用;點擊“公式”中的“錯誤檢查”;在列表中選擇“循環(huán)引用”,查看循環(huán)引用單元格;找到單元格并修改公式;就不會提升循環(huán)引用了。

4、出現(xiàn)這樣問題的原因:你的公式引用范圍包含公式所在單元格,比如你在A2單元格內(nèi)向輸入求和公式=SUM(A1:A3),那么A2就是循環(huán)引用了。

5、所以循環(huán)引用一般情況下是錯誤的引用導(dǎo)致的,需要修復(fù)才行;在高版本的excle中這種引用會有提示符,如下圖所示:也有的情況是允許這種循環(huán)執(zhí)行一定次數(shù),比如100次,然后就停止,可在選項中開啟此功能,一般人用不到此功能。

ios問題:請問下邊的代碼是不是循環(huán)引用

1、循環(huán)引用的實質(zhì)是,多個對象之間相互強引用,導(dǎo)致不能釋放,讓系統(tǒng)回收。iOS開發(fā)中常見的循環(huán)引用主要是由Delegate、NSTimer和block引起。

2、自循環(huán)引用 相互循環(huán)引用 多循環(huán)引用 假如有一個對象,內(nèi)部強持有它的成員變量obj, 若此時我們給obj賦值為原對象時,就是自循環(huán)引用。

3、造成循環(huán)引用的原因,就是兩個及兩個以上的對象相互強引用,無法釋放。

4、但是 singleton 持有self 導(dǎo)致 self 不能被釋放,因此,self 無法被釋放,導(dǎo)致內(nèi)存泄漏。

5、公式引用的對象,直接或間接地引用了當前單元格本身。所以給出錯誤提醒。

6、不支持在較新版本上安裝較早版本的 iOS。恢復(fù)循環(huán)(恢復(fù)成功完成后系統(tǒng)再次提示恢復(fù)):此問題通常是由已過期或配置不正確的第三方安全軟件所致。如果 USB 故障診斷不能解決此問題,請按照“故障診斷安全軟件問題”中的步驟執(zhí)行操作。

ios有哪幾種常見的引起循環(huán)引用情況,如何解決

解決方案:在viewWillDisappear中銷毀timer 通知 添加觀察者和移除觀察者,要成對出現(xiàn)。如果只添加了觀察者,沒有移除觀察者,會引起循環(huán)引用,導(dǎo)致控制器不能釋放。

自循環(huán)引用 相互循環(huán)引用 多循環(huán)引用 假如有一個對象,內(nèi)部強持有它的成員變量obj, 若此時我們給obj賦值為原對象時,就是自循環(huán)引用。

NSTimer是一種很容易忽略的循環(huán)引用的情況。因為timer會強引用self,而self又持有了timer,這就造成了循環(huán)引用。

出現(xiàn)循環(huán)引用的三種情況:聲明代理delegate屬性 使用block時 使用NSTimer的時候 代理屬性導(dǎo)致循環(huán)引用。

在合適的時間回調(diào)Block,而不希望回調(diào)Block的時候Block已經(jīng)被釋放了,所以我們需要對Block進行copy,copy到堆中,以便后用。

當前題目:ios開發(fā)循環(huán)引用舉例 ios循環(huán)引用原理
網(wǎng)頁網(wǎng)址:http://bm7419.com/article24/dieedje.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供關(guān)鍵詞優(yōu)化、營銷型網(wǎng)站建設(shè)、品牌網(wǎng)站制作面包屑導(dǎo)航、網(wǎng)站導(dǎo)航

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

綿陽服務(wù)器托管